I used 2 LC239D integrated circuits. They are 3-pin h-bridges, two per circuit. Having two of them allows you to control four motors. Just hook up everything correctly, following the LC239D's pin layout here: http://www.rakeshmondal.info/L293D-Motor-Driver It isn't that difficult once you understand the basics.
